Range Closure
March 18, 2020

Dear DCGC Members,

We have been informed by the Dakota County Sheriff’s Office that DCGC is required to follow executive order 20-40 and shut down the range until March 27th. We hope this will not be extended but only time will tell.

Until then, access to the range will be denied. If you need access to the clubhouse to retrieve training materials or other reasons, please contact the board. Requests will be taken on a case-by-case basis.

All scheduled events during this time frame are cancelled; All March re-orientation sessions are cancelled and the DCGC Firearm Safety classes that were to begin April 2nd previously called off by the DNR.

Thank you in advance for following these guidelines for your safety and health as well as others during this very difficult time.

No one is happy we were ordered to close. We checked with the state, got bounced around until we were told to check with the Sheriff's office since they were enforcing the closures, and they said we were under the closure order. I half-jokingly asked the board what the penalty for staying open was and never got an answer, but it's probably best to not poke the LE bear.

With luck we can open again at the end of the month.
